The Candle Star
Runaways hidden in the barn. Slave catchers lodged in the hotel. And Emily caught in the middle.

Emily Preston has defied her parents one too many times, and they expel her from their plantation home. Forced to travel to Detroit, she's sentenced to a year's labor in her Uncle Isaac's hotel.

In retaliation, Emily has vowed to become the most disagreeable houseguest ever, but she didn't figure in her uncle's iron will. And she has no idea what to do with Malachi Watson, the son of freed slaves who challenges every idea she's grown up believing.

When Emily stumbles across two runaways hidden in her uncle's barn, Malachi requests her help to sneak them across the river to Canada. Meanwhile, Mr. Burrows, the charming Southern slave catcher, lodges in the hotel.

Fans of Ann Rinaldi will appreciate The Candle Star's strong female protagonist, meticulous historical detail, and rich literary style.

About the Author

I love children's literature. I became a teacher, in part, because I never outgrew these wonderful stories. When I tried my hand at one, I was hooked! So who am I and what do I write? Let me nutshell that with three words:

Adventure - I won't read a story that doesn't transport me to a new, exciting world. I won't write one, either.

Innocence - My target audiences range from 9 to 15. Kids. I'll never market profanity or controversy to them. Instead, I rely on solid, old-fashioned story-telling.

Substance - I prefer stories with some depth to them. A hero who grows and learns and changes can influence a reader to do the same. Layers of meaning will push readers into new areas of thinking.

Though I write material appropriate for younger readers, many a grown-up has applauded my work and asked, "Why is this just for kids?"
